IN LOVING MEMORY OF
Anna E.
Mezei
August 9, 1924 – January 3, 2025
Anna E. Mezei, of Brookfield, OH, formerly a lifelong resident of Hermitage, passed away peacefully with family at her side Friday morning, January 3, 2025, in her home.
Mrs. Mezei was born August 9, 1924, in Brackenridge, PA, a daughter of the late Anthony and Catherine (Agresti) Trotta.
After graduating from Farrell High School in 1942, Anna worked as a core tester at the former Sharon Transformer Div. of Westinghouse Electric Corp.
On May 11, 1946, she married Andrew "Red" Mezei, and the couple enjoyed nearly 62 years together. He preceded her in death on March 29, 2008.
A homemaker, Anna was also an Avon Representative for over 25 years, earning many awards and making many good friends.
A founding member of the Church of the Good Shepherd in West Middlesex, Anna belonged to the Altar Rosary Society, was active with the fundraising group "Caterers," and was active in the former "Pastry Blenders." She also volunteered annually as "Mrs. Santa" for the children taking C.C.D. classes. She was also a member of St. John XXIII Auxiliary and volunteered at the Keystone Blind Association.
Anna enjoyed baking, sewing, reading, traveling, and most importantly, spending time with her family and pets.
